The All New Volvo S80

S80

 

The all new S80, introduced in 1998 and no doubt the ultimate replacement for the dated 900/S90 series, is really a stunner. Starting off with a naturally aspirated 2.9-litre inline-6 producing 201bhp at 6000rpm and 207lb-ft of torque; or the tarmac munching T6 with a 2.8-litre inline-6 twin turbo grinding out 272bhp at 5400rpm and 236lb-ft of torque at a friendly low 2000rpm. New to the Volvo line-up will be the General Motor's 4-Speed automatic gearbox with a semi-auto "Geartronic" feature shifter.

Interior

Accessories are a must in a luxurious saloon (sadly there will not be a V80), the S80 comes with a built in mobile phone with key controls that can be operated from the wheel for hands free communications. A optional satellite navigation system to get your location fast, a four disc integrated CD changer for your mobile studio and lots of courtesy lights. Electric seats, cruise control, trip computer and air-conditioning are standard on this luxo-rig. In addition to the standard quad airbags and "SIPS", Volvo has introduced the Whiplash Protection System ("WHIPS") for rear-end collision protection. For side-impacts, a inflatable curtain drops from the headliner alone the side windows to protect against head and neck injuries.

Specifications for Volvo S80T6

Engine Transverse front-mounted, 2783cc twin turbo inline-6 24v DOHC
Bore/stroke, mm 91.0/90.0
Compression ratio : 1 8.5
Power 272bhp at 5400rpm
Torque 236lb-ft at 2000-5000rpm
Transmission / Drive Automatic 4-Speed Geartronic / Front wheel drive
Suspension f/r MacPherson struts, lower transverse links with anti-roll bar / Transverse links, control arms, coil with anti-roll bar
Brakes f/r Vented discs / discs, ABS
Tires f/r 225/50 ZR17
Dimensions L 4822/ W 1832 / Wheelbase 2791mm
Weight 1489kg
Max Speed 155mph / 260km/h
0-62mph / 0-100km/h 7.2sec
mpg (approx) 25.9
